Mods/Fixes:

Well, I pulled off the running boards and threw some flaps on the front. Then I had some 285 BFG AT's installed. I installed a new antenna stalk. I fixed the cup holder door and threw in some new floor mats. I also put some new Toyota shocks on. They were only $24 each. I also did the 7-pin mod. That's the deal for the boat ramp by the way.

I also started to baseline the maintenance. I did a gear lube change, wheel bearing repack. Serp belt, air cleaner, etc.. I will be doing the T Belt pretty soon too.


I did have a small problem intially. When I removed the resonator to change the serp belt I noticed that one of the emissions nipples that sends vacuum to the charcoal canister was broken. I glued it back on but unfortunately it threw a code P0442 I think. Anyway I got under the hood and determined that I glued the hole shut, so the emission system had ho vacuum to purge with. I shaved the old nipple off and tapped a hole for a brass nipple. Reset the code and it hasn't been back in two months.
